Recognizing Common Scams on Americanas

Be aware of the following prevalent scams that could affect your purchase of an AMD RX 9070 XT:

  • **Fake PIX Payment Page:** Scammers create convincing but fake payment pages designed to steal your financial information when you believe you are completing a legitimate PIX transaction. They might impersonate official bank or platform pages to trick you into entering your credentials or card details.
  • **Look-alike URL Phishing:** These scams involve creating website URLs that closely mimic the official Americanas domain or the manufacturer's website. By making minor alterations to the URL (e.g., slight misspellings, different domain extensions), scammers can lure you to a fraudulent site where they capture your login details or payment information.
  • **Third-Party Ghost Seller:** On platforms like Americanas, third-party sellers operate. 'Ghost sellers' are fraudulent accounts that list products they don't actually possess. Once a purchase is made, they disappear, taking your money without ever shipping the item. These sellers often have suspiciously low prices or brand-new accounts with little to no history.
  • **B2W Partner Impersonation:** B2W is a major digital commerce company in Brazil, and Americanas is part of it. Scammers may impersonate 'B2W Partners' or other legitimate partners to gain your trust, potentially directing you to fake payment portals or requesting sensitive information under the guise of a partnership or verification process.
  • **In-App 'Off-Platform' Request:** Be wary if a seller, through the Americanas messaging system, tries to move the transaction outside the platform. They might claim better prices or fewer fees, but this bypasses Americanas' buyer protection and makes it impossible to recover funds if something goes wrong.
  • **Impossible Price Flash Sale:** While deals are common, prices that are impossibly low (e.g., 70-90% off) for a high-value item like the RX 9070 XT are a major red flag. Scammers use these 'too good to be true' offers to lure unsuspecting buyers into paying for non-existent products or to steal payment details.
  • **Fake Cashback Multiplier:** Scammers might promote fake cashback offers that seem too good to be true. This could involve directing you to a third-party site to 'register' for the cashback, where they then steal your personal information or payment details.

How to Protect Yourself

  • **Verify the Seller:** Always check the seller's rating, reviews, and history on Americanas. Be cautious of new sellers with no or few reviews, especially when selling high-value items.
  • **Scrutinize Pricing:** If a deal seems too good to be true for an AMD RX 9070 XT, it likely is. Compare prices across different reputable retailers.
  • **Use Official Payment Channels:** Conduct all transactions exclusively through Americanas' secure checkout. Avoid any requests to pay via direct bank transfer, PIX outside the platform, or other unofficial methods.
  • **Inspect URLs Carefully:** Before entering any login or payment information, double-check the website's URL for any subtle differences from the official Americanas domain.
  • **Beware of Urgency Tactics:** Scammers often create a sense of urgency to prevent you from thinking critically. Take your time and don't be rushed into a purchase.
  • **Use Secure Payment Methods:** Utilize credit cards or secure payment gateways that offer buyer protection.
